The proposal to amend the Sedition Act 1948 is among the main issues to be given attention by the Perak Umno Liaison Committee at the party's general assembly on Nov 29.

State Umno information chief Datuk Mohd Khusairi Abdul Talib said this was because amendments to the act were the topic of discussion among the people at the grassroots level, with the majority urging that the act be retained.

"This issue will definitely be the main focus of the delegates, not only from Perak, but also from other states as most people want the act to be retained to ensure the country's peace and stability," he told Bernama here today.

He said efforts to strengthen the party machinery during the 14th General Election would also be another issue which would be the main focus of the delegates, especially when debating on the Umno president's address.

Mohd Khusairi said the issue needed to be debated as part of Perak Umno's efforts to ensure the party would be ready to face the general election.

On the economic resolution, he said it would cover many areas and the delegates would probably touch on the issue of the increase in petrol prices, as well as the Goods and Services Tax.

Mohd Khusairi said a sub-committee at the Umno state-level would discuss issues to be debated and appoint the delegates to do so.

He said Kampar Umno division head Datuk Radhi Manan would debate the presidential address; Tambun Umno Youth chief Mohamad Ziad Mohamed Zainal Abidin on the resolution pertaining to religion and education; and, Bukit Gantang division head Datuk Syed Abu Hussin Hafiz Syed Abdul Fasal, the resolution on economy.

Perak Umno is expected to send 704 delegates from 24 divisions to the general assembly.
